Optimal Timing for Waterproofing Projects

Proper timing ensures durability and effectiveness by choosing dry, mild weather periods for waterproofing.

Proper timing for waterproofing projects is essential to ensure durability and effectiveness. The optimal period depends on local climate conditions, temperature stability, and moisture levels. Typically, the best time for waterproofing is during dry, mild weather when temperature ranges are moderate and there is minimal risk of rain or freezing temperatures.

Spring Waterproofing

Spring offers a window of moderate temperatures and lower humidity, making it suitable for waterproofing projects before the heavy rains of summer.

Summer Waterproofing

Summer is ideal when temperatures are warm and consistent, allowing for proper curing of waterproofing materials. However, it is important to avoid the hottest days to prevent rapid drying.

Fall Waterproofing

Fall provides cooler temperatures and less humidity, which can enhance the application process. Timing is crucial to complete projects before winter sets in.

Winter Considerations

Winter is generally not recommended for waterproofing due to freezing temperatures and increased moisture, which can compromise the integrity of the materials.

Waterproofing is a critical component in protecting structures from water intrusion, which can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. Proper application and timing ensure that waterproofing materials adhere correctly and perform effectively over time. Advances in waterproofing technology have improved durability, with modern products offering resistance to UV exposure, temperature fluctuations, and aging. Statistics indicate that timely waterproofing can extend the lifespan of foundations and roofs by several years, reducing maintenance costs and preventing water-related issues.
